Output 70a120f375723e05852a333be1ab627b8a09fc1a721f06a306e809eb118e8916:0

value
34180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 998ee85e6902af0954aa66815b11c0bce23ab71e OP_EQUAL
address
3FgxWJ22HNzSUXZGZVX93pePKPQ3KbG8eZ
transaction
70a120f375723e05852a333be1ab627b8a09fc1a721f06a306e809eb118e8916
spent
true